Tips for Off-Roading With a 4WD Camper
When you hit the road with a 4WD camper, preparation is vital to ensuring a secure and delightful off-roading experience - 4WD Camper Hire. Begin by acquainting on your own with your car's capacities and restrictions. Know its ground clearance, wheelbase, and 4WD functions. Prior to you set off, check the weather condition and path problems to stay clear of unexpected challenges.While driving, maintain a stable speed, and do not hurry-- this assists you navigate difficult places much more effectively. Use low equipment when tackling high slopes or declines; it offers you better control. Always pick your line wisely, going for steady ground to avoid obtaining stuck.Keep an eye on your surroundings, as barriers can appear promptly. If you experience a hard area, consider turning back rather than running the risk of damage. Finally, traveling with a buddy, or a minimum of notify a person of your path and anticipated return time for included safety. Delight in the journey!

Often Asked Questions
What Is the Common Rental Cost for a 4WD Camper?
Regular rental expenses for a 4WD camper array from $100 to $300 per day, depending upon the design, rental firm, and period. You'll intend to look around for the very best offers and accessibility.
Exist Age Constraints for Leasing a 4WD Camper?
Yes, there are age restrictions for renting a 4WD camper. Usually, you must be at least 21, however some firms need you to be 25. Always inspect certain rental plans before booking your journey.
Do I Need an Unique Motorist's Certificate for a 4WD Camper?
You do not usually require an unique chauffeur's permit for a 4WD camper, as long as you hold a legitimate typical license. However, constantly contact the rental company for certain demands or restrictions.
Can I Take a Rented 4WD Camper Off-Road?
Yes, you can take a rented 4WD camper off-road, but check with the rental firm. They usually have specific plans and constraints regarding off-road use that you'll need to adhere to. Enjoy your adventure!
What Insurance Coverage Choices Are Offered for 4WD Camper Rentals?
When renting out a 4WD camper, you'll normally discover choices like liability, accident, and comprehensive insurance. It's vital to review these options meticulously, as they can safeguard you from unanticipated expenses during your journey.
